After a challenging week that saw major stock indices experience a decline, futures are showing signs of recovery as the market gears up for a busy earnings season. The Dow, S&P 500, and Nasdaq futures all indicate a positive opening, suggesting that investors are regaining confidence ahead of key financial reports.
This week is particularly significant as several high-profile companies, including Nvidia, are set to release their earnings. Analysts are keenly observing these reports, as they could provide valuable insights into the health of the technology sector and the broader economy. The anticipation surrounding Nvidia's performance is especially high, given its pivotal role in the semiconductor industry and its contributions to artificial intelligence.
In addition to corporate earnings, market participants are also awaiting important economic data releases that could influence investor sentiment. As the week unfolds, traders will be closely monitoring both earnings results and economic indicators, which will play a crucial role in shaping market trends moving forward.
